About the Program
June is Pride Month and this year it has extra meaning for the LGBTQ+ community, allies and advocates.  On June 15th, Justice Gorsuch, writing for the 6-3 majority of the United States Supreme Court, handed down the long-awaited decision in three consolidated cases: Bostock v. Clayton County, Altitude Express Inc. v. Zarda, and R.G. Harris Funeral Homes Inc. v. EEOC.  The dispute in these cases revolved around the meaning of “sex” in Title VII: whether discrimination because of “sex” covers discrimination based on sexual orientation and gender identity, not just based on being a man or a woman.
